I am friends of Chad's family and I can tell you that as far as the sheriff's department is concerned Chad's case was closed the night they found him dead.  When Chad's family went up to Albuquerque and spoke to the state's omi they were told that they have to work off of the evidence that is sent to them.  They aren't a CSI unit and can't go collect their own evidence, they have to depend on the law enforcement offices to do for them.

They did agree that Chad died from carbon monoxide poising but the large amount didn't agree with the residue that wasn't on the car, the garage door and any thing else in the garage door.  With the amount in his body the items listed above should have been covered in it and it wasn't.  The lead detective didn't even bother to send the beer can in the console up to be analyzed and see what was in it.  Most people that dip can tell you that they will take a can (coke or beer) and squeeze it in the middle so that no one will drink from it and they will know that it is a spit can.

The sheriff's department didn't even bother to go and talk to Chad's employer or their employees to see what Chad's mental state was in the weeks or months leading up to his death.  If they had they would have been told about the threatening phone calls and several other things that had happened. 

Waller did tell Chad's mother that he was sorry that his department dropped the ball on Chad's case but  NEVER did he offer to reopen it.  At that time he had the power to do that.  Would Mendoza do it now?  Who knows.  It will be interesting to see if Waller is around when Mendoza 1st tern is up and he runs for his second time.  Mendoza may find that he doesn't need Waller's extra weight.

No one hotmamma you are correct, it was Estrada.  He wasn't there 15 minutes when he called it.  Vickie (Chad's mother) tried to talk to him and he wouldn't listen.  Chad's dad was out of town and when he found out that he was out by 7 Rivers he told everyone that he was going home to bed and IF Mr. Wood wanted to talk to him, he could call him in the morning and left.  Paul wasn't 20 to 30 minutes away.

Sunnydayz, Mendoza was in charge of Artesia at that time and he did sit in on several of the meetings but didn't have anything to do with Chad's case as far as I know.
